Transaction 3cf18520c56a2226560fd57d7c40a902147f6ecf147d4e73902eb20f65f275ff
1 Input
1 Output
-
3cf18520c56a2226560fd57d7c40a902147f6ecf147d4e73902eb20f65f275ff:0
- value
- 2253665364
- script pubkey
- OP_0 OP_PUSHBYTES_20 40446649320b13ca2aa497090be703df8773e13f
- address
- bc1qgpzxvjfjpvfu524yjuyshecrm7rh8cflpvh9gz